The Evolution of Car Keys
1. Standard Keys:
In the early days of automotive history, car keys were basic metal cut keys, utilized solely to mechanically open doors and start the vehicle. These conventional keys were easy to replicate but didn't use much in terms of security.
2. Transponder Keys:
Introduced in the mid-1990s, transponder keys reinvented automotive security. Embedded with a microchip, these keys send out a distinct signal to the car's ignition system. Vehicles will only start if they acknowledge the correct signal, including a layer of security against theft.
3. Remote Key Fobs:

4. Smart Keys and Keyless Ignition:
The newest in automotive key innovation, wise keys or proximity keys enable users to start and stop the vehicle with a push-button ignition system. They allow the vehicle to acknowledge when the key is close by, providing unparalleled convenience and security.
The Role of a Car Locksmith
Car locksmith professionals are extremely experienced specialists who focus on a variety of services. Here are a few of their main responsibilities:
Key Replacement and Duplication:
Whether due to loss, theft, or damage, replacing car keys is among the most common jobs carried out by locksmith professionals. With their knowledge, they can replicate and replace traditional, transponder, and even some clever keys.
Lockout Services:
Being locked out of a vehicle is a common predicament dealt with by numerous drivers. Locksmith professionals leverage specialized tools and strategies to safely open car doors without causing any damage.
Ignition Repair and Replacement:
Issues with a car's ignition system can prevent a vehicle from starting. Locksmith professionals examine these issues and can repair or replace ignitions as necessary.
Programming Transponder Keys:
Given the complexity connected with transponder keys, locksmith professionals frequently help with programming them to interact with a vehicle's ignition system.
Advanced Security System Installation:
Modern lorries frequently come equipped with sophisticated security systems. Car locksmiths offer setup and upkeep services for these innovative systems to guarantee they function properly.
The Technology Behind Lock and Key Security
Advancements in technology have actually changed how locksmith professionals work. Here's a glance into a few of the key innovations utilized today:
- Laser Key Cutting: Laser cutting makers are utilized for high precision, ensuring keys fit completely into their particular locks.
- OBD-II Programming Tools: On-Board Diagnostics (OBD) tools assist locksmiths in accessing a car's computer system to program keys, particularly for more recent designs.
- Key Code Retrieval: Modern locksmiths can obtain distinct car key codes from manufacturers, enabling accurate duplication and programming.
FAQs About Car Key and Locksmith Services
What should I do if I lose my car keys?
- Contact an expert locksmith who can replace your keys. Make sure to supply evidence of ownership for the vehicle.
Can a locksmith make a key for a car without the original?
- Yes, numerous locksmith professionals can produce a key utilizing the vehicle's ignition lock or by retrieving the key code.
How long does it require to replace a car key?
- The time can vary depending on the key type and the locksmith's availability, with traditional keys taking less time compared to transponder and clever keys.
Is it more affordable to go to a locksmith or a dealership for key replacement?
- Normally, locksmith professionals offer more economical services compared to car dealerships for key replacement services.
Can locksmith professionals program all kinds of car keys?
- While the majority of locksmiths can deal with a vast array of keys, some state-of-the-art models may require specialized services available just through the dealership.
